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
946256400 24149017 72623755284 25 65
239099087 15926 289824
239099087 15926 289824
11361078 4928 0136548
All about undefined
Interested in learning more?
239099087 15926 289824
11361078 4928 0136548
See more
63870 9696919 8776311
78 8509383 8271 8562226588
See more
3802512 03978132
561387164 68 801
See more